Package es.mdef.gaip_libreria.utilidades
Class ValidacionesHelper
java.lang.Object
es.mdef.gaip_libreria.utilidades.ValidacionesHelper
Clase de utilidad para realizar diversas validaciones relacionadas con actos, invitados y localidades configuradas.
Proporciona métodos estáticos para validar la coherencia entre estas entidades.
Esta clase no está diseñada para ser instanciada.
-
Method Summary
Modifier and TypeMethodDescriptionstatic booleanvalidadInvitadoParaLocalidadConfigurada(Invitado invitado, LocalidadConfigurada localidadConfigurada) Valida si un invitado está asignado al mismo acto que la localidad configurada.static booleanvalidadLocalidadConfiguradaActo(LocalidadConfigurada localidadConfigurada, Acto acto) Valida si una localidad configurada pertenece al acto especificado.static booleanvalidarInvitadoActo(Invitado invitado, Acto acto) Valida si un invitado está asignado al acto especificado.
-
Method Details
-
validarInvitadoActo
Valida si un invitado está asignado al acto especificado.- Parameters:
invitado- El invitado a validar.acto- El acto con el que se compara.- Returns:
- true si el invitado está asignado al acto, false en caso contrario.
-
validadLocalidadConfiguradaActo
public static boolean validadLocalidadConfiguradaActo(LocalidadConfigurada localidadConfigurada, Acto acto) Valida si una localidad configurada pertenece al acto especificado.- Parameters:
localidadConfigurada- La localidad configurada a validar.acto- El acto con el que se compara.- Returns:
- true si la localidad configurada pertenece al acto, false en caso contrario.
-
validadInvitadoParaLocalidadConfigurada
public static boolean validadInvitadoParaLocalidadConfigurada(Invitado invitado, LocalidadConfigurada localidadConfigurada) Valida si un invitado está asignado al mismo acto que la localidad configurada.- Parameters:
invitado- El invitado a validar.localidadConfigurada- La localidad configurada a comparar.- Returns:
- true si el invitado y la localidad configurada pertenecen al mismo acto, false en caso contrario.
-